School Ufficials Supervise Working for the passage of the school levy was a part of this year,s job for Lowell A. Small, superintendent of the Hutchinson school system. Mr. Small, past president of the Kansas State Teachers Association, holds a Bachelor of Science degree from Kansas Wesleyan University, and a Master of Arts in administration from Colorado University. He has also been awarded an honorary degree of Doctor of Literature. An honorary mem- ber of the Kappa Delta Phi fraternity, Mr. Small completed his post graduate work at Oregon Uni- versity and Missouri University. Interviewing new teachers, presenting recom- mendations to the school board, supervising the activities of the .elementary grade schools, two junior highs, high school and junior college, were a part of carrying out his duties as superintendent of the Hutchinson public schools. 6 THE PRO'S AND CON'S-Mrs. l.
